Репозиторий Снегопата переехал на GitHub

02.10.2020      96204

Инфостарт объявляет об изменении основного хранилища скриптов Снегопата – теперь вся история разработки, регистрация ошибок и пожеланий по проекту будет вестись в репозитории на GitHub.

Fossil уже недостаточно

Снегопат – инструмент для разработчиков, и с момента своего появления был ориентирован на сообщество программистов. Как результат – значительная часть скриптов для Снегопата была создана и поддерживалась небольшим, но дружным сообществом. Вся разработка велась в едином репозитории, размещенном на сайте проекта snegopat.ru, а общение сообщества скриптописателей и просто пользователей Снегопата велось на форуме сайта проекта.

В качестве системы контроля версий проект Снегопат использовал «карманную» систему контроля версий – fossil. Это самодостаточная VCS с крутыми возможностями и более простым интерфейсом командной строки, чем GIT, т.е. более понятная для новичков.

Она отлично подходила для командной разработки в 2011 году, когда Git еще не был стандартом и конкурировал с другими VCS, в том числе с fossil, а про GitHub в сообществе 1С мало кто знал.

Сегодня же, когда говорят «система контроля версий», то подразумевают Git, а когда говорят про публичный Git-репозиторий проекта, то имеют в виду репозиторий на GitHub.com. 

С момента появления новых версий Снегопата, выпущенных под эгидой Инфостарта, сообщество пользователей Снегопата активизировалось, к нему начали подключаться новые участники, и стало очевидно, что взаимодействовать с сообществом через репозиторий fossil и форум неудобно.

Поэтому с 1 октября проект Снегопат обосновался на GitHub.com по адресу: https://github.com/infostart-hub/snegopat

Преимущества переезда

Основная цель переезда на GitHub – упростить взаимодействие с пользователями Снегопата и разработчиками скриптов. Мы хотим, чтобы новые скрипты, улучшения, исправления ошибок быстрее и без лишних сложностей для авторов скриптов попадали в поставку проекта.

В GitHub принят удобный и всем знакомый процесс разработки через пулл-реквесты (GitHub Flow), который знают все, кто пользуется современными инструментами контроля версий. Не нужно разбираться с fossil, запрашивать доступ на коммит в репозиторий Снегопата и ждать получения прав.

Также появляется простой и понятный интерфейс для управления списком задач и багов. Пользователи Снегопата – разработчики, и у большинства уже есть аккаунты на GitHub.com, а значит, не нужна дополнительная регистрация.

Переезд репозитория Снегопата позволит основной команде разработки проекта улучшить взаимодействие с пользователями и скриптописателями, систематизировать обратную связь и будет способствовать дальнейшему развитию скриптов и популяризации Снегопата.

Исходный код скриптов открыт – прислайте пулл-реквесты и сообщайте о проблемах и пожеланиях в issues!


Автор:
Ведущий 1С разработчик


Комментарии
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
1. Einzelhaft 6 02.10.20 20:28 Сейчас в теме
Сделайте тег #SMFREE что не надо платить за это
+
2. ktb 620 02.10.20 23:16 Сейчас в теме
Это конечно не совсем репозиторий, а скорее артифакторий. :-)
Раз уж нет желания открыть исходники, то лучше, наверное, будет разделить репы ядра и плагинов.
+
3. kuntashov 449 03.10.20 00:35 Сейчас в теме
(2)
Это конечно не совсем репозиторий, а скорее артифакторий. :-)


Это связано с тем, что репозиторий fossil импортирован на GitHub как есть, в его исходном виде. В новости опущена техническая деталь: fossil использовался не только как система контроля версий, но и как средство дистрибуции и система обновления Снегопата и бандла скриптов.

В сегодняшних реалиях такой способ дистрибуции признан не очень удобным и ведется работа по изменению подхода к распространению Снегопата и обновлений, но пока она не завершена, структура репозитория оставлена без изменений, чтобы ничего не ломать у текущих пользователей.

(2)
нет желания открыть исходники


Исходники всего прикладного кода ядра открыты, см. подкаталоги v8api и engine.


(2)
лучше, наверное, будет разделить репы ядра и плагинов


Спасибо, мы думаем над этим. Как уже написал, репозиторий пока переехал в своем исходном виде, чтобы не сломать ничего у текущих пользователей, но при этом не тормозить активность сообщества скриптописателей.
amon_ra; artbear; JohnyDeath; support; ktb; +5
4. kuntashov 449 05.10.20 10:27 Сейчас в теме
Баги из форума https://snegopat.ru/forum/viewforum.php?f=8 экспортированы на github https://github.com/infostart-hub/snegopat/issues c тегом "forum"

Переписка вся объединена в одно сообщение, но логины авторов и ссылки на исходное сообщение на форуме сохранено.
JohnyDeath; artbear; +2
5. DrAku1a 1715 10.10.20 12:16 Сейчас в теме
Это всё хорошо, но когда 64-битную версию ждать?)
+
6. kuntashov 449 10.10.20 19:22 Сейчас в теме
(5) Неофициально - скоро, официально:
Прикрепленные файлы:
+
Оставьте свое сообщение

См. также

Готова программа конференции «Анализ и управление в ИТ-проектах»

Новость Aнализ&Управление Мероприятия

Сегодня подводим итоги 2 тура голосования и публикуем список докладов и других активностей, вошедших в финальную программу конференции «Анализ и управление в ИТ-проектах».

вчера в 17:00    193    eselyanina    0       

16

Продлеваем прием заявок на конкурс «Современные возможности 1С: нетиповые интеграции и доработки»

Новость Сообщество

Заявки с вашими нетиповыми интеграциями продолжают поступать, поэтому мы ненадолго продлеваем прием. Теперь «заявиться» на конкурс можно до 20 апреля включительно.

17.04.2024    198    user997184    0       

1

Как использовать SmartWay в 1С для планирования командировок

Новость Сервисы ИТС

Smartway – решение для планирования и организации командировок, разработанный на базе российского ПО. Просто задайте направления и даты, а Smartway сравнит цены на билеты или гостиницы в режиме реального времени, предложит выгодные варианты

17.04.2024    204    user997184    0       

2

Расширяем возможности типового 1С-ЭПД: автозаполнение электронной транспортной накладной для нескольких реализаций

Новость Маркетплейс ЭДО

Из документа «Транспортная накладная», входящего в состав расширения «Мастер ТТН», теперь можно отправлять ЭТрН через типовую подсистему 1С-ЭДО, расширяя ее возможности автозаполнением всех требуемых реквизитов.

16.04.2024    290    Olga_Amelchenkova    0       

3

Приглашаем на первый бесплатный вебинар Комплексного курса по управлению ИТ-проектами

Новость Обучение Руководитель проекта

17 апреля стартует Комплексный курс по управлению ИТ-проектами. Курс начнется с бесплатного welcome-вебинара, где мы поговорим о компетенциях современного руководителя и расскажем подробно о программе курса.

16.04.2024    462    AnastasiaKl    1       

14

Обновлены материалы для подготовки к сертификации по 1С:ERP

Новость 1С:ERP Управление предприятием 2

Фирма «1С» доработала материалы для подготовки к тестированиям 1С:Профессионал и 1С:Специалист-консультант по конфигурации 1С:ERP Управление предприятием 2. С 26 апреля тестирование будет проводиться по обновленному комплекту вопросов.

16.04.2024    268    ЕленаЧерепнева    0       

1

Фирма «1С» возглавила ежегодный рейтинг франшиз по версии РБК

Новость ИТ-Новость

РБК ежегодно составляет рейтинг наиболее популярных российских франшиз. На протяжении многих лет фирма «1С» лидирует среди прочих предложений на рынке франчайзинга.

15.04.2024    297    ЕленаЧерепнева    0       

1

Фирма «1С» дополнила перечень продуктов, которые подорожают с 1 июля 2024 года

Новость

Обновление прайс-листа 1С на типовые и отраслевые лицензии в этом году проводится в два этапа – с 1 апреля и 1 июля. В список конфигураций, которые подорожают летом, добавлено еще несколько позиций.

15.04.2024    1240    ЕленаЧерепнева    0       

1

Сегодня, в 12:00, стартует бесплатный вебинар Марии Темчиной по разбору ошибок в управлении ИТ-проектами

Новость Обучение Руководитель проекта

Успейте подключиться к онлайн-встрече, где на реальных кейсах мы разберем проблемные ИТ-проекты, узнаем, как избежать ошибок или как исправить совершенные.

15.04.2024    897    AnastasiaKl    0       

2

Обновление «1С:Документооборот КОРП 3.014»: очень много приятных мелочей

Новость

В релиз «1С:Документооборот КОРП 3.014» вошли улучшенные интеграции с 1С-сервисами: они расширяют возможности конфигурации. Улучшена функциональность самого продукта – разработчики добавили новые инструменты для работы с документами и файлами.

12.04.2024    1404    ЕленаЧерепнева    0       

2

Бесплатный онлайн-вебинар «1С:Аналитика – BI-система на платформе 1С»

Новость

Приглашаем на бесплатный вебинар по системе «1С:Аналитика», где мы поговорим о ее возможностях, расскажем реальные кейсы успешного внедрения системы, а также в формате круглого стола ответим на вопросы слушателей.

11.04.2024    1650    AnastasiaKl    1       

15

Отвечаем на вопрос: зачем публиковать свои решения в Базе знаний Инфостарт

Новость Сообщество

Если вы еще сомневаетесь, вливаться ли в наше сообщество, обязательно прочитайте эту статью.

11.04.2024    932    Sofya_Sukur    6       

25

Фирма «1С» актуализировала состояние плана задач для 1С:Предприятие 8.3.27

Новость Зазеркалье

Опубликован перечень задач, которые планируется реализовать для технологической платформы версии 8.3.27. Большая часть задач отмечена как выполненные, часть перенесена на следующий релиз, задач со статусом «в работе» в плане не осталось.

10.04.2024    631    ЕленаЧерепнева    0       

2

Учет по проектам в 1С Бухгалтерии v 2.9: главные обновления

Новость Маркетплейс

Учет рабочего времени по проектам и распределение заработной платы по отработанным часам в новой версии расширения «Учет по проектам в 1С:Бухгалтерии 3.0». Рассказываем об обновлениях подробнее.

09.04.2024    1017    user997184    0       

2

Сегодня стартует курс по 1С:Аналитике: успейте присоединиться

Новость Обучение

Сегодня, в 16:00 по Мск, состоится первый из четырех вебинаров онлайн-курса «Работа с 1С:Аналитика». Еще есть время записаться на обучение, где вы узнаете, как работать в системе и максимально использовать ее функционал.

09.04.2024    841    AnastasiaKl    0       

15

Бесплатный вебинар «Аналитика маркетплейсов из одного окна»

Новость Маркетплейс

На вебинаре разберемся, как селлеру свести воедино информацию со всех торговых площадок, чтобы отслеживать динамику продаж и не терять товары. Вместе со спикером поднимем актуальные для селлеров вопросы по аналитике.

08.04.2024    890    user997184    0       

13

12 апреля – бесплатный вебинар «Быстрый анализ медленных операций системы 1С»

Новость

12 апреля состоится бесплатный вебинар о том, анализировать проблемы производительности 1С с помощью программного продукта «Алькир». На вебинаре протестируем «Алькир» в работе и с его помощью проверим гипотезы при расследовании проблем.

08.04.2024    1172    user997184    1       

16

INFOSTART TECH EVENT 2024: 11 апреля меняем цены на участие

Новость Infostart Event Мероприятия

Осенняя конференция Инфостарт пройдет с 10-12 октября 2024 года. Чем ближе дата мероприятия, тем меньше скидка на покупку билетов на конференцию. Очередное плановое изменение цены произойдет 11 апреля.

08.04.2024    1012    AnastasiaKl    0       

16

Объявляем прием заявок в секцию «Открытый микрофон»

Новость Aнализ&Управление Мероприятия

Постоянная рубрика конференции «Анализ и Управление в ИТ-проектах» – «Открытый микрофон». Для вас – это возможность попробовать свои силы, продвинуть личный бренд и все-таки выступить с докладом, если вы не пройдете в финальную программу.

04.04.2024    983    user997184    0       

15

В сервисе «1С-Курьерика» для автоматизации собственной доставки обновлены тарифы

Новость Сервисы ИТС

Фирма «1С» сообщила о начале продаж нескольких дополнительных тарифов для подписки на сервис «1С:Курьерика» . Например, теперь клиентам предлагают бесплатный промо-тариф на месяц.

04.04.2024    943    ЕленаЧерепнева    2       

2

Отвечаем на вопросы по работе с GitFlic – российским аналогом решений для хранения, обмена и работы с кодом

Новость

11 марта на Инфостарт прошел бесплатный вебинар-знакомство с продуктом GitFlic. GitFlic – первая российская платформа для удобной и быстрой работы с исходным кодом, и его хранения.

03.04.2024    1208    user997184    0       

1

Работа с 1С:Аналитика: старт курса через неделю

Новость Обучение Программист

9 апреля, во вторник, начнется обучение на курсе по системе «1С:Аналитика». На курсе мы узнаем о возможностях системы, в том числе и об обновленном функционале, и научимся в ней работать.

02.04.2024    1119    AnastasiaKl    0       

15

Заполните анкету и получите 15+ полезных материалов для руководителей проектов

Новость Обучение Руководитель проекта

Мы собрали бесплатный гайд для начинающих руководителей, в котором разбираем основные проблемы на управленческом пути каждого руководителя и подсказываем, как можно с ними справиться.

01.04.2024    1323    AnastasiaKl    0       

16

Единый семинар 1С – регистрируйтесь и получайте подарки от Инфостарт

Новость Сервисы ИТС

Уже в среду, 3 апреля, состоится «Единый семинар 1С». Онлайн-семинар предназначен для бухгалтеров, финансовых директоров, ИТ-специалистов и кадровых работников предприятий малого и среднего бизнеса.

01.04.2024    1106    user997184    0       

16